Description

"Lessons From Everest: 7 Powerful Steps to the Top of Your World" is "Into Thin Air" meets "The Secret" with a sprinkle of humor. After a devastating failed attempt to climb Mt.Everest and a brief period of mourning, the author became focused on learning the lessons that had been revealed to him while hiking alone in the Khumbu Valley of Nepal. After testing those lessons to within an inch of his life on the worlds highest mountain he realized those same lessons were universal to people seeking to overcome difficulties in life or simply to edge a little closer to their human potential. This inspirational book with high-adventure memoir elements describes these seven lessons.
